Akshay Joshi <me@akshayjoshi.com> wrote:

> I am very new to submitting patches to the kernel. Do I just modify the
> patch file and add an Acked-by line to the patch notes or do I have to do
> something else?

If you've got a whole bunch of acks, then it may make sense to resubmit your
patches with them included and a note in patch 0 saying that that's all that
you've done.  This is one of the downsides of this process - it doesn't cope
so easily with additions of this type.
